Where it comes from

This iconic dessert from the village of Cambo-les-Bains reflects the sweet side of Basque culture, with its contrast of creamy custard or jam and crumbly pastry, often enjoyed at family gatherings.

How it's made

  1. 1

    Mix flour, butter, sugar, and lemon zest until crumbly.

  2. 2

    Add eggs and rum, forming a dough, and chill it.

  3. 3

    Roll out the dough and line a tart pan, keeping some for the top.

  4. 4

    Fill with black cherry jam or almond cream.

  5. 5

    Cover with remaining dough, seal edges, and bake until golden.
